Chat with us, powered by LiveChat

Could there be any clearer sign that Stallion Master of Design is a license to print money.

A $2.1 Million Yearling, a winner of $1Milion on the track, and covers 120 mares in his first season.

All this and a unique marking of a huge $ sign staring you in the face !

Pin It on Pinterest